The user expects dimensions for a defined base-cabinet construction method, not a universal formula.
For a cabinet with full-height sides and top and bottom fitted between them, board thickness directly changes the internal width. State that construction rule beside every generated part.

Specify material, thickness, finish, grain and edge treatment together. Substituting one property can affect machining, hardware, weight and final dimensions.
Confirm the exact product data, opening path, ventilation and service position. Generic appliance blocks are useful for planning but the selected model controls the final clearance.
Use the exact manufacturer family and its technical table. Count rules are a planning baseline; drilling, load and clearance data control the released result.
